Transaction 759c90c9896c577e8f26482497cdce5fc5fc0a7feae00cc2d3efc121aabc978e

8 Input
2 Outputs
  • 759c90c9896c577e8f26482497cdce5fc5fc0a7feae00cc2d3efc121aabc978e:0
  • value  10000000
    address  17wtSxJHtFEPQqMPp2JCZvxmWUhBYNcCzv
  • 759c90c9896c577e8f26482497cdce5fc5fc0a7feae00cc2d3efc121aabc978e:1
  • value  3235900
    address  1K894iTnAbqRNMgZMGgLUwbe4hch4TRT5T